EXO's Record-Breaking Album Sales For 'XOXO' - Impressive!

There is no doubt that SM Entertainment mega boy band EXO is wildly popular, but now they have gone and officially proven it.

The twelve-member Chinese-Korean pop group has toppled over 700,000 copies sold of their first full-length studio album XOXO.

A statement from EXO's record label, SM Entertainment, early September 4 revealed that "According to the Korean Music Industry Association, they are the first artist to break the record of selling over 700,000 in twelve years since 2001 with Kim Gun Mo's 7th album and Jo Sung Mo's 4th album."

EXO has sold 424,260 copies of the original XOXO album and an additional 312,899 of the repackaged version.

That brings sales to nearly 740,000 since the album's release three months ago on June 3.

The repackaged album was released in August and includes EXO's latest single "Growl."

Comparatively, the last two artists to break 700K, Kim Gun Mo and Jo Sung Mo, sold 1,390,000 and 960,000 copies respectively.

For over a decade, no other artist has seen such numbers for physical album sales, which is largely due to the growing popularity of digital downloads and music streaming sites.

Meanwhile EXO continues to garner international attention for their scheduled promotional activities and music performances for "Growl."
